  1. /* SPDX-License-Identifier: GPL-2.0 */
  2. #ifndef __LINUX_BOOTMEM_INFO_H
  3. #define __LINUX_BOOTMEM_INFO_H
  4. #include <linux/mm.h>
  5. #include <linux/kmemleak.h>
  6. /*
  7. * Types for free bootmem stored in page->lru.next. These have to be in
  8. * some random range in unsigned long space for debugging purposes.
  9. */
  10. enum {
  11. MEMORY_HOTPLUG_MIN_BOOTMEM_TYPE = 12,
  12. SECTION_INFO = MEMORY_HOTPLUG_MIN_BOOTMEM_TYPE,
  13. MIX_SECTION_INFO,
  14. NODE_INFO,
  15. MEMORY_HOTPLUG_MAX_BOOTMEM_TYPE = NODE_INFO,
  16. };
  17. #ifdef CONFIG_HAVE_BOOTMEM_INFO_NODE
  18. void __init register_page_bootmem_info_node(struct pglist_data *pgdat);
  19. void get_page_bootmem(unsigned long info, struct page *page,
  20. unsigned long type);
  21. void put_page_bootmem(struct page *page);
  22. /*
  23. * Any memory allocated via the memblock allocator and not via the
  24. * buddy will be marked reserved already in the memmap. For those
  25. * pages, we can call this function to free it to buddy allocator.
  26. */
  27. static inline void free_bootmem_page(struct page *page)
  28. {
  29. unsigned long magic = page->index;
  30. /*
  31. * The reserve_bootmem_region sets the reserved flag on bootmem
  32. * pages.
  33. */
  34. VM_BUG_ON_PAGE(page_ref_count(page) != 2, page);
  35. if (magic == SECTION_INFO || magic == MIX_SECTION_INFO)
  36. put_page_bootmem(page);
  37. else
  38. VM_BUG_ON_PAGE(1, page);
  39. }
  40. #else
  41. static inline void register_page_bootmem_info_node(struct pglist_data *pgdat)
  42. {
  43. }
  44. static inline void put_page_bootmem(struct page *page)
  45. {
  46. }
  47. static inline void get_page_bootmem(unsigned long info, struct page *page,
  48. unsigned long type)
  49. {
  50. }
  51. static inline void free_bootmem_page(struct page *page)
  52. {
  53. kmemleak_free_part(page_to_virt(page), PAGE_SIZE);
  54. free_reserved_page(page);
  55. }
  56. #endif
  57. #endif /* __LINUX_BOOTMEM_INFO_H */
